What’s In Chai Tea Latte Starbucks?

What’s in starbucks chai tea latte? It’s made with 2% milk, water, and a chai tea concentrate that includes black tea, cardamom, black pepper, ginger, cinnamon, cloves, star anise, and vanilla What is Starbucks chai latte made of? Who Acquired Starbucks?

Starbucks was founded in 1971 by jerry baldwin, Zev Siegl, and Gordon Bowker at Seattle’s Pike Place Market. During the early 1980s, they sold the company to howard schultz who – after a business trip to Milan, Italy – decided to convert the coffee bean store into a coffee shop serving espresso-based drinks. How Long Does Cold Brew In A Box Last?

Stored in a sealed container in the fridge, cold brew concentrate can last for 7–10 days If you add water to the concentrate before storing or are keeping a cold brew from a coffee shop in the fridge, it’s best to consume within 3–4 days. How long is packaged cold brew good for? If it’s … Read more
